How to Start an Affiliate Marketing Business

Starting an affiliate marketing business offers a lucrative opportunity to earn income with minimal investment. This guide explains the basics of affiliate marketing, including how to sign up for programs, promote products, and earn commissions. You’ll also learn about choosing the right niche, evaluating affiliate programs, and building a solid online presence to maximize your success.


How do I start affiliate marketing as a beginner?

Starting affiliate marketing as a beginner involves choosing a niche, selecting affiliate programs, and creating content to promote products. You’ll need to build a website or use social media to share your affiliate links, driving traffic through SEO, email marketing, and social media engagement. Consistency and patience are key to growing your audience and earning commissions.

How much does it cost to start an affiliate marketing business?

The cost of starting an affiliate marketing business can be minimal. Basic expenses include purchasing a domain name and web hosting. These initial costs can range from about $35 to $200. Additional costs may include marketing tools, paid advertising, and professional services if needed.

Can a beginner make money from affiliate marketing?

Yes, a beginner can make money from affiliate marketing. Success depends on the effort, strategy, and time invested. While some may see results quickly, it’s common for beginners to take a few months to generate significant income. By focusing on quality content and targeted traffic, even beginners can earn consistent commissions over time.

How do I start an affiliate with no money?

Leveraging free resources makes starting affiliate marketing with no money possible. Use social media platforms, free blogging sites like Medium or, and SEO to drive organic traffic. Additionally, you can join affiliate programs that don’t require a website and promote products through social media, forums, and email marketing. Be creative and resourceful to build your audience and earn commissions without upfront costs.

Understanding how to start an affiliate marketing business

Learning how to start an affiliate marketing business can be a great way to generate a new income stream with minimal upfront costs. Below, we’ll break down what affiliate marketing involves and introduce you to some essential terms.

Understanding how to start an affiliate marketing business.

The basics of starting an affiliate marketing business

Affiliate marketing is a performance-based marketing strategy where you earn a commission for promoting someone else’s products or services. Here’s a step-by-step breakdown:

  1. Sign up for an affiliate program: Choose a program that fits your niche, such as Amazon Associates.
  2. Promote products: Use your unique affiliate links on your website, social media, or email newsletters.
  3. Generate clicks: Encourage your audience to click on these links to visit the product page.
  4. Earn commissions: If your audience makes a purchase, you get a portion of the sale.

Since it’s performance-based, the more traffic and clicks you generate, the higher your potential earnings.

Affiliate marketing vocabulary

It helps to learn some key terms:

  • Affiliate: The person who promotes the products.
  • Commission: The earnings you receive from sales generated through your link.
  • Clicks: The number of times your unique affiliate link is clicked.
  • Conversion rate: The percentage of clicks that result in sales.
  • Affiliate network: A platform that connects affiliates with merchants (e.g., ShareASale or ClickBank).

Understanding these terms will make navigating affiliate programs easier and help you optimize your strategies to maximize earnings.

Choosing your niche

Finding the right niche is crucial for your affiliate marketing business. You need a balance of market demand, personal passion, and potential sales to engage your audience effectively.

Researching profitable affiliate marketing trends

  1. Identify market trends: Use tools like Google Trends to see what’s popular. Look for growing interests rather than declining ones.
  2. Analyze competitors: Study other affiliate marketers in potential niches. Check their content and note what seems to work for them.
  3. Keyword research: Tools like Ahrefs or Keywords Explorer can show you the search volume for specific terms. Higher volume means more potential traffic.
  4. Evaluate affiliate programs: Ensure there are reliable programs with decent commissions in the niche. A high demand with no monetization options won’t be helpful.

Aligning passion with business

  1. List your interests: Jot down things you are passionate about or have expertise in. This will make content creation enjoyable and sustainable.
  2. Match interests to market demand: Compare your list with profitable niches to find overlaps. An area where passion meets market needs is ideal.
  3. Test audience engagement: Start with small content pieces or social media posts to see how your audience responds. High engagement can indicate a promising niche.
  4. Assess long-term viability: Make sure you can continually generate content ideas. A niche you love plus a willing audience equals sustainable success.

Identifying the right affiliate marketing programs

Choosing the right affiliate programs is crucial to your success when starting an affiliate marketing business. You should examine the commission structures and decide whether to join an affiliate network or an independent program.

Evaluating commission structures

When evaluating commission structures, you should consider the following factors:

  1. Commission rate: Higher rates mean more money for you. Programs like Amazon Associates offer lower rates than specialized programs on ClickBank or ShareASale.
  2. Payout frequency: Look for programs that pay monthly or bi-weekly. This keeps your cash flow steady.
  3. Cookie duration: Longer cookie durations mean better chances of earning commissions. Some programs offer 24-hour cookies, while others can last up to 90 days.
  4. Conversion rates: Programs with higher conversion rates usually generate better earnings. Check testimonials or reviews from other affiliates to get an idea.
  5. Product relevance: Make sure the products are relevant to your audience. This increases the chances of clicks and purchases.

Comparing rates, cookie duration, payout frequency, and product relevance for your audience can help you identify your best affiliate program.

Program Commission rate Cookie duration Payout frequency
Amazon Associates Low Short Monthly
ClickBank High Long Bi-Weekly
ShareASale Medium Medium Monthly

Affiliate networks vs. independent programs

When deciding between affiliate networks and independent programs, consider these points:

Affiliate networks:

  • Offer a wide range of products from different companies.
  • Platforms like ClickBank and ShareASale make tracking and managing commissions easier.
  • Networks often provide resources like banners, links, and marketing advice.

Independent programs:

  • Often, they offer higher commissions since there’s no middleman.
  • You communicate directly with the merchant, which can result in better support.
  • Smaller programs might have unique products, making them highly relevant to niche audiences.

Each option has advantages. Affiliate networks provide convenience and a broad selection, while independent programs offer potentially higher earnings and more personalized support. Choose what best aligns with your business model and audience.

Setting up your affiliate marketing business

Establishing a solid online presence and understanding legal considerations are key to starting an affiliate marketing business. Follow the steps below to set yourself up for success.

Establishing your online presence

Building an online presence is essential for any affiliate marketer. Start with creating a website or blog. Use platforms like WordPress or Wix, which are user-friendly and affordable.

  1. Choose a niche: Pick a topic you are passionate about, and that has a market demand.
  2. Register a domain: Your domain name should be easy to remember and related to your niche.
  3. Set up hosting: Determine the best web hosting solution. Reliability and performance are important, but you’ll also want a user-friendly interface and good customer service.
  4. Design your site: Use templates to make your site look professional. Ensure it’s mobile-friendly and easy to navigate.

Starting an affiliate marketing business website using the AI Website Builder is easy. Start by visiting and selecting Generate a website.

The AI Website Builder offers three ways to generate a website based on:

  • Your description,
  • Your favorite affiliate marketing business site,
  • A new, blank WordPress site with your choice of professional pre-made templates.

For example, start by creating a new website with AI and select your type of business.

Then, describe your business and let AI generate a customizable website in just minutes.

Generating an affiliate marketing business website with 10Web AI.

After your website is live, start creating quality content. 10Web’s AI editing tools help create high-quality blog posts, reviews, and tutorials that can attract visitors.

The 10Web Builder's AI content editing tools.

Use SEO techniques like keyword optimization to improve your site’s visibility on search engines.

Promote your site through social media channels. Platforms like Instagram, Facebook, and Twitter are excellent for sharing your content and engaging with your audience. Always include affiliate links in your content to drive sales and earn commissions.

Legal considerations for affiliates

Legalities are crucial when starting an affiliate business. First, disclose your affiliate relationships to build trust and comply with laws.

  1. Understand FTC guidelines: The Federal Trade Commission requires you to disclose that you earn commissions from affiliate links. Place a disclosure statement on your website, ideally at the beginning of posts containing affiliate links.
  2. Privacy policy: Create a privacy policy to inform visitors how you collect, use, and protect their data. This is especially important if you use tools that track user behavior.
  3. Terms of service: Outline the rules for using your website and your services. This can protect you from legal issues.
  4. Business structure: Decide if you’ll operate as a sole proprietor, LLC, or another business type. An LLC can offer you personal liability protection.

Taking these steps helps ensure your business is legally compliant, fosters trust, and protects your assets. Also, always stay informed about changes in regulations affecting affiliate marketing.

Creating high-quality content

Creating high-quality content is essential for engaging your audience and building trust, ultimately driving sales. Focus on making your content valuable and relevant.

Content strategies for engagement

To engage your audience, you must create content that resonates with them. Here are some strategies to help you do that:

  1. Write product reviews: Reviews help people make informed purchase decisions. Be honest and detailed.
  2. Create tutorials and how-to guides: Show your audience how to use a product effectively.
  3. Make comparisons: Comparing similar products can help your audience choose the best option for their needs.
  4. Develop resource pages: Assemble useful resources on a topic, making your site a go-to place for information.

Example of engaging content types:

Type Description
Product reviews Detailed analysis of a product
How-to guides Step-by-step instructions
Comparisons Side-by-side feature comparisons
Resource pages Collection of useful links/info

Building trust through content

Building trust is crucial in affiliate marketing. Trust encourages people to buy based on your recommendations. Here’s how you can build trust:

  1. Be honest and transparent: Always disclose your affiliate relationships.
  2. Provide valuable content: Ensure your content helps your audience solve problems.
  3. Show expertise: Share your knowledge and experience.
  4. Engage with your audience: Respond to comments and questions.

Key points to remember:

  • Honesty: Never mislead your readers.
  • Transparency: Clearly state when content is monetized.
  • Expertise: Demonstrate your knowledge in your niche.

Example of trust-building content tactics:

Tactic Description
Honest Reviews Share both pros and cons
Transparency Include affiliate disclosure
Expertise Use real-life examples and tips
Engagement Reply to comments and feedback

Optimizing for search engines

Focusing on search engine optimization (SEO) is crucial for maximizing affiliate marketing success. This will help you attract more visitors and increase your potential earnings.

A technology themed illustration of SEO and affiliate marketing websites.

Keyword research for affiliate marketing businesses

Researching the right keywords is the first step in optimizing for search engines. Use tools like Google Keyword Planner or Ahrefs to find keywords your target audience is searching for.

Look for keywords with a balance of high search volume and low competition. It’s important to choose keywords that are relevant to the products or services you promote.

Make a list of primary and secondary keywords. Primary keywords should be broad and have higher search volumes, while secondary keywords should be more specific and targeted.

Use these keywords throughout your content, in titles, headings, and meta descriptions.

SEO best practices

Following best practices in SEO ensures higher search engine rankings. Here are some essential tips:

  1. Create quality content: Focus on providing valuable and relevant information to your audience. High-quality content helps build authority and trust with both users and search engines.
  2. Optimize page load speed: Faster pages improve user experience and are favored by search engines. Use tools like Google PageSpeed Insights to identify and fix issues.
  3. Use alt text for images: Adding descriptive alt text to your images improves accessibility and helps search engines understand your content.
  4. Internal and external linking: Link to other relevant pages on your site and authoritative external sources. This helps to build authority and keeps visitors engaged.

Leveraging social media platforms

Using social media can greatly benefit your affiliate marketing business. Choose platforms that align with your audience and employ strategies to grow your followers effectively.

Choosing the right platforms for your audience

To begin, identify where your target audience spends most of their time.

Facebook remains popular among a broad age range, while Instagram and TikTok attract younger users who enjoy visual and video content. For more in-depth reviews and demos, consider YouTube.

Understanding your audience’s interests and habits helps you choose the most effective platforms for your affiliate marketing efforts.

Use analytics tools to see which platforms your audience engages with most. This helps ensure your content reaches the right people and maximizes engagement.

Strategies for growing your following

Building a strong social media following is crucial. Start by creating engaging and consistent content.

Authenticity matters; your posts should feel natural and relate to your audience’s interests.

Interact with your followers regularly. Respond to comments and messages to build a community.

Using hashtags effectively can increase your visibility. Try to post at optimal times when your audience is most active.

Collaborate with influencers or other affiliates to tap into their follower base. Running giveaways or exclusive promotions can also attract new followers.

Monitor your growth and adjust strategies based on what works best.

Growing your affiliate marketing business with email marketing

Email marketing can be a powerful tool for your affiliate marketing business. By building a strong email list and crafting engaging newsletters, you can reach potential leads and convert them into loyal customers.

Building your email list

To start, you need a reliable email list.

Begin by creating a landing page with opt-in forms. These forms should be easy to find on your website. The goal is to encourage visitors to sign up for your emails.

Use an email service provider (ESP) to manage your contacts. Create a new list in your ESP for your email subscribers. Then, embed email signup forms on multiple pages.

Make sure these forms offer something valuable, like a free eBook or a discount.

Promote your signup forms through social media and other channels. The more ways people can find your forms, the better.

Lastly, always ensure your forms are mobile-friendly to capture leads on any device.

Crafting effective email newsletters

Creating newsletters is key to keeping your audience engaged.

Your emails should be informative and relevant. Start with a catchy subject line that grabs attention.

Include clear calls to action (CTAs) to guide your readers on what you want them to do next.

For instance, you might want them to visit a product page or read a blog post.

Use bold text and buttons for your CTAs to make them stand out.

Personalize your emails as much as possible. Use the subscriber’s name and tailor the content to their interests. This makes the email feel more personal and relevant.

Lastly, track the performance of your emails using analytics.

Look at open rates, click-through rates, and other metrics to see how your emails are performing. Use this data to improve future newsletters.

Engaging with video and podcasting

Using video and podcasting can boost your affiliate marketing efforts. Here’s how to start on YouTube and podcasting to create engaging content that resonates with your audience.

Starting your affiliate YouTube channel

  1. Pick a niche: Focus on a specific topic that aligns with your affiliate products.
  2. Create quality content: Invest in a good camera and microphone. Solid visuals and clear audio are key.
  3. Consistency matters: Upload videos regularly. Establish a schedule to keep your audience engaged.
  4. Integrate affiliate links: Add affiliate links in video descriptions. Always disclose when you use affiliate links.
  5. Engage with viewers: Respond to comments and create a community. Engage through likes, shares, and comments.

Launching an affiliate podcast

  1. Choose a podcast topic: Pick a topic your audience loves and is related to your affiliate products.
  2. Invest in equipment: Use a good-quality microphone and headphones to ensure clear audio.
  3. Create engaging content: Plan episodes ahead. Combine solo episodes and guest interviews to keep it interesting.
  4. Include affiliate mentions: Share your affiliate links during episodes. Mention them clearly and provide value.
  5. Promote your podcast: Share each episode on social media and other platforms. Utilize your network to increase reach.

Analyzing your affiliate performance

Keeping track of your affiliate performance is essential for growing your business. You’ll need to monitor how well your affiliate links are doing and find ways to boost your conversion rates. Here’s how you can do it effectively.

Tracking your affiliate links

To know which links are bringing in the most clicks and revenue, you need to track them closely.

Start by using analytics tools that offer detailed reports. These tools can show you metrics like:

  • Clicks: How many times a link has been clicked.
  • Earnings per click (EPC): How much revenue each click is generating.
  • Commissions: The total earnings from each link.

Google Analytics and ClickMeter are popular choices for tracking affiliate links.

You can also use shortened links with tools like Bitly, which provide extra analytics features.

Step-by-step guide:

  1. Set up an analytics tool.
  2. Add tracking codes to your affiliate links.
  3. Review the performance regularly.
  4. Adjust your strategies based on the data.

Improving conversion rates

Improving your conversion rate is about turning more clicks into actual sales.

To start, A/B test different versions of your landing pages to see which one performs better. This can include changes like:

  • Headlines: Try different wording to see what grabs attention.
  • Call-to-action buttons: Experiment with size, color, and text.
  • Images and content layout: Different visuals or layouts can impact conversions.

Key metrics to track include:

  • Conversion rate: The percentage of clicks resulting in purchases.
  • Average order value (AOV): The average amount spent per order.
  • Customer lifetime value (CLV): The total revenue you can expect from a customer over time.

Using these metrics, you can understand what’s working and what needs improvement.

Don’t forget to look at benchmark data from competitors to set realistic goals for your performance.

Regularly make small tweaks and track their impact to improve your affiliate marketing efforts steadily.

Scaling your affiliate marketing business

Expanding your affiliate marketing business involves growing your affiliate networks and advancing your strategies to include multiple channels. Doing so will help you increase your passive income and boost sales.

Growing affiliate networks

Start by partnering with more affiliate networks to diversify your income streams.

Different networks offer unique opportunities, so joining multiple networks can introduce you to a variety of profitable niches.

Utilize data analytics to identify and focus on high-performing affiliates. This approach helps you invest resources effectively.

Develop strong relationships with your affiliates. Regular communication and support foster loyalty and improve performance.

Offer exclusive deals or higher commissions to top performers. Incentives motivate affiliates to prioritize your products.

Lastly, maintain transparency with your partners. Sharing insights and strategies builds trust and encourages collaboration.

Advancing to multi-channel strategies

Expand your reach by incorporating multiple marketing channels. This way, you can engage with a broader audience.

Social media is a powerful tool. Platforms like Instagram, YouTube, and TikTok allow you to create engaging content. This content can drive traffic to your affiliate links.

Consider email marketing. Build and nurture an email list to keep your audience informed and interested in your products.

Leverage content marketing. Blogs, articles, and other content help you provide valuable information. They also subtly incorporate your affiliate links.

Don’t overlook paid advertising. Investing in ads on search engines and social media can significantly increase your visibility and drive more sales.

Summing up

Affiliate marketing is a dynamic and accessible way to generate income. You can start a successful affiliate marketing business by understanding key concepts, choosing the right niche, and leveraging effective strategies. Stay informed about industry trends and continuously optimize your approach to maintain growth and profitability in your affiliate marketing journey.

Simplify WordPress with 10Web

Share article

Leave a comment

Your email address will not be published. Required fields are marked *

Your email address will never be published or shared. Required fields are marked *


Name *